Restoring Mobility: Stem Cell Treatment for Knee Cartilage Repair
Knee osteoarthritis is a debilitating condition affecting millions worldwide. This degenerative disease causes cartilage breakdown, leading to pain, stiffness, and limited mobility. Traditional treatments often focus on managing symptoms, but stem cell therapy offers a promising new approach to restoring joint function. Stem cells possess the unique ability to differentiate into various cell types, including those that make up healthy cartilage. By injecting these potent cells into damaged areas of the knee, doctors aim to stimulate tissue regeneration and repair. Early clinical trials demonstrate encouraging results, with patients experiencing reduced pain, increased mobility, and improved quality of life. While further research check here is needed, stem cell therapy holds great potential for transforming the treatment landscape for knee osteoarthritis.

Stem Cell Promise: From Disk Repair to Diabetes Therapy
Stem cells possess remarkable potential in regenerative medicine, offering revolutionary solutions for a diverse array of debilitating conditions. From repairing damaged disks to treating the progression of diabetes, stem cell therapies are on the cusp of transforming healthcare as we know it. One fascinating application lies in regenerating intervertebral disks, the flexible structures that connect vertebrae in the spine. By inducing the growth of new disk tissue, stem cells could alleviate pain and improve mobility for patients suffering from degenerative disk disease. Moreover, stem cell therapies hold tremendous promise in the treatment of diabetes. By differentiating stem cells into insulin-producing beta cells, researchers could potentially alleviate type 1 diabetes, a chronic condition that affects millions worldwide.
Understanding Stem Cells: The Building Blocks of Life
Stem cells represent the fundamental units from our bodies. These remarkable entities possess the incredible ability to self-renew, meaning they can divide and create more stem cells, ensuring a continuous supply. Additionally, stem cells have the talent to differentiate into a wide variety of specialized cell types, such as muscle cells, nerve cells, or blood cells. This adaptability makes them crucial for development and repair throughout our lives.
